Will Rolt Monty Stand Alone? is about a sheriff, anxious to hang up his badge and leave with his mail order bride. Trouble is, there’s one last stand he has to face with an enemy and it’s iffy whether or not the odd townspeople will help him, or not. This is a classic little western with bits of humor and a moderate amount of old west action violence.

The Western Mail Order Bride: Love & Silver In Marlboro Valley, is set in a new silver mining town in Colorado, in 1871. Men outnumber women ten to one and a rancher, Brigham Whitestar, seeks a mail order bride. At the same time, a former young outlaw, Cody Johnson, also wishes for a bride. They arrive at the mail order bride offices in town at exactly the same time and wait for their brides a couple of months later on the train platform. The trouble is, only the woman intended for Brig arrives. An intense rivalry starts from then on as both men vie for the affections of Greta Stein, the European woman who is cultured, speaks three languages, and knows how to ride racehorses.
